Cape Woolamai

Cape Woolamai is a small town and headland on the tip of Phillip Island. Speaking of waves, the beach at Cape Woolamai is one of the most popular in Australia for surfing, so if you like to catch some waves, come visit this mecca! It is such a popular surfing beach that it has been designated a National Surfing Reserve. Cape Woolamai also has the obvious added bonus of a nearby Koala Conservation Centre, as well as lots of national parks, glorious trails through beaches and shores, and a marine island national park too.
